What We Believe

We hold to the essentials that Christians across all traditions share:

  • God — one God in three persons: Father, Son, and Holy Spirit
  • Scripture — the Bible is God’s inspired Word and our guide for faith and life
  • Jesus Christ — fully God and fully human, crucified, risen, and coming again
  • Grace — salvation is a gift from God, received through faith in Jesus Christ
  • Love — the greatest commandment is to love God and love our neighbour
  • Hope — death is not the end; God is making all things new

Where Christians differ — on baptism, communion, church structure, spiritual gifts, and other important questions — we present the perspectives of different traditions with respect and without taking sides. We believe thoughtful Christians can disagree on secondary matters while standing together on what matters most.
